Why WPM Accuracy Matters:

  • Average typing speed for adults: 40 words per minute
  • Professional requirements typically demand: 60-80 WPM
  • Advanced secretarial and transcription roles: 80-100+ WPM
  • Elite competitive typists achieve: 120+ WPM with high accuracy

Optimize Your Typing Test Performance

Understanding the factors that affect typing speed helps maximize both test results and real-world productivity:

Professional Technique Fundamentals:

  • Proper Finger Placement: Use all ten fingers with correct home row positioning (ASDF for left hand, JKL; for right hand)
  • Touch Typing Method: Maintain visual focus on screen content rather than keyboard, developing muscle memory for key locations
  • Ergonomic Posture: Sit upright with relaxed shoulders, wrists floating above keyboard level to prevent strain and improve fluidity
  • Rhythm and Flow: Develop consistent keystroke timing rather than bursts of speed followed by hesitation

Training Strategies for WPM Improvement:

  • Accuracy First: Focus on error reduction before speed increases - accuracy improvements naturally lead to faster typing
  • Real-World Practice: Train with actual text passages containing punctuation, numbers, and varied vocabulary
  • Progressive Difficulty: Start with comfortable speeds and gradually increase target WPM goals as muscle memory develops
  • Consistent Practice: Regular 15-20 minute sessions yield better results than sporadic intensive training

Common Typing Mistakes (And How to Fix Them)

1. Peeking at the Keyboard

Looking down constantly breaks your typing rhythm. Use muscle memory and type with all ten fingers to build consistent accuracy. Cover your hands or use keycap stickers to reduce dependency.

2. Overusing Backspace

Too much correction breaks your flow. Focus on accuracy first, then build speed. Our tool highlights live mistakes so you can adjust in real time.

3. Inconsistent Hand Position

Always return to the home row (ASDF / JKL;) and use a relaxed wrist angle. Ergonomic posture helps prevent fatigue and increases typing endurance.

FAQ About Typing Speed Testing

Average typing speed for adults is 40 WPM. Professional jobs typically require 60-80 WPM. Advanced roles like transcription or court reporting demand 80-100+ WPM. Elite competitive typists can exceed 120 WPM while maintaining high accuracy.
